Anyone know how to view the power supply status? I got notified by NOC that PSU0 failed but I can only check inventory status on controller. You used to be able to determine power supply status right on the front page in AireOS.

Show platform is the command. Wish this was still in the GUI.
Chassis type: C9800-40-K9
Slot Type State Insert time (ago)
--------- ------------------- --------------------- -----------------
0 C9800-40-K9 ok 17w2d
0/0 BUILT-IN-4X10G/1G ok 17w2d
R0 C9800-40-K9 ok, active 17w2d
F0 C9800-40-K9 ok, active 17w2d
P0 C9800-AC-750W-R ok 17w2d
P1 C9800-AC-750W-R ok 17w2d
P2 C9800-40-K9-FAN ok 17w2d
Slot CPLD Version Firmware Version
--------- ------------------- ---------------------------------------
0 19030712 16.10(2r)
R0 19030712 16.10(2r)
F0 19030712 16.10(2r)

Try:
show log
show env summ (min/major alarms in last column)
show facility-alarm status
agreed it's weird that they've removed the PSU status from the show env output!
